Students learn clerical skills The business classes offered to GHS students this year were Personal Typing, Typing I, Typing II, Shorthand, Bookkeeping, and Vocational Office Practice. These classes offer a realistic view of what it would be like to work in a business or be a secretary, and they teach the skills needed to work in these positions. The teachers of these classes are Mr. Ken Reed and Mrs. Janet Nietzel. Junior, Amy Harriman stops to take her typing paper out of her machine, while senior. Students go to Regionals Choir students sold candles to raise money for scholarships and new uniforms for the middle school choir. Five students from Accapella choir tried out for the Regionals Honor Choir at Central Michigan University. Of the five that participated, Tom Doane, Dan Ammes, Kathy Muns, juniors, and Sharon Demorest, and Jeff Greunke, seniors, two made it into the choir. They were Jeff Greunke and Kathy Muns. Keeping with past traditions, the choirs presented their annual Fall, Christmas, and Spring Concerts at the High School and the Middle School.
